Letters of thanks
As part of our learning about the Rena and the Wildlife Response Team we decided to write letters. We wrote to thank the workers for the amazing job they are doing cleaning and looking after the wildlife.
We were so suprised to get an email inviting us to be part of the penguin release on Thursday 8th December. It was an amazing day and Lucy, Joseph and Manawa were chosen to open the penguin box. We loved watching the peguins going back to their homes. They were very cute!

Rena Disaster
We have looked at newspaper articles, watched video clips and talked about the Rena disaster.
Here are some of our thoughts
The Rena tipped over sideways and got stuck on the reef. It spewed some oil over by the Mount. I feel sad because some of the penguins died. Jess
The Rena ship got stuck by the Mount. The oil leaked out of the boat. Lots of people helped clean the oil up. Journey
The Rena fell sideways onto the reef. The Rena spilt oil on the beach and some penguins got covered in oil. Some big boxes fell off the Rena. I feel sad because it was very sad. Neva
The Wildlife Rescue Centre helps the animals that are covered in oil. First they use canola oil to take the other oil off. Then they go under a nice warm lamp to dry. After that they go into a swimming pool to have a swim. Lucy

Chocolate Peppermint Balls
Room 11 made peppermint balls for Fathers Day. Earlier in the year Jada's Mum helped us to make some for Mothers Day. They were so delicious that we didn't want Dad to miss out.
Some of the children in Room 11 would like to make them at home.
Here is the recipe
1 packet of chocolate thins
1/2 tin of condensed milk
1 tsp of peppermint essence
1 T cocoa
coconut
Put biscuits into blender and crush. Add the condensed milk, essence and cocoa. Roll into balls and coat in coconut. Enjoy!!!
Thanks Jada's Mum for the yummy recipe.

Working as a team
We read the story "The Little Blue Duck" which is a kiwiana version of "The Little Red Hen". We used our red thinking hat and talked about how the little blue duck felt when nobody would help her make the pavlova.
We decided it was much better to work as a team SO we made a pavlova together with everyone helping! It was delicious!!!
